Buying a limited company involves acquiring ownership of an existing company that is registered as a legal entity separate from its owners. It differs from starting a new company as it comes with an established business history, assets, and liabilities. Understanding the process of purchasing a limited company is crucial for entrepreneurs seeking to acquire an existing business rather than starting one from scratch.
There are numerous advantages to buying a limited company. It provides a faster market entry, as the company already has an established customer base and market presence. Additionally, acquiring an existing company eliminates the need to build a business from the ground up, saving time and resources. Furthermore, it offers access to an existing infrastructure, including employees, suppliers, and distribution channels.
